Transaction 59e3e2978a788373436d9fe107ca9d004cef90a9437b693286cd915eff79d8d3

167 Input
2 Outputs
  • 59e3e2978a788373436d9fe107ca9d004cef90a9437b693286cd915eff79d8d3:0
  • value  1205587155
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 59e3e2978a788373436d9fe107ca9d004cef90a9437b693286cd915eff79d8d3:1
  • value  973368
    address  3BGfbAFJbz9TU4gBXQjDopbtgFeJS4ZFm4